Как построены базы данных и зачем они требуются
Базы данных представляют собой упорядоченные репозитории данных, которые применяются почти во всех современных компьютерных структурах. Каждый день миллионы человек взаимодействуют с базами данных, даже не осознавая об этом. Когда пользователь активирует социальную сеть, осуществляет приобретение в интернет-магазине или смотрит состояние карты, за кулисами действуют сложные комплексы контроля данными.
Первостепенная задача базы данных заключается в упорядочении и размещении огромных объёмов сведений. Сведения размещаются в определённых форматах, которые обеспечивают стремительно выявлять нужные информацию. up x осуществляет не только удержание, но и продуктивную анализ данных.
Современные базы данных созданы по методу матриц, где сведения распределяется по строкам и столбцам. Выделенные утилиты регулируют обращением к данным и контролируют за непротиворечивостью информации. ап икс официальный сайт помогает составлять запутанные запросы для извлечения нужной сведений за мгновения секунды.
Что такое база данных и её первостепенное назначение
База данных — это систематизированная совокупность информации, структурированная для удобного сохранения, нахождения и анализа. Такие системы хранят структурированные данные о клиентах, изделиях, транзакциях и иных сущностях. Данные размещается в структурированном виде, что обеспечивает моментально получать доступ к требуемым элементам.
Ключевое предназначение базы данных выражается в единообразном администрировании сведениями. Вместо сохранения информации в распределённых файлах предприятия эксплуатируют единое хранилище. ап икс оптимизирует взаимодействие с данными и предотвращает размножение записей.
Базы данных решают задачу многопользовательского доступа к данным. Несколько работников могут параллельно взаимодействовать с аналогичными и теми же сведениями без коллизий. up x обеспечивает непротиворечивость данных даже при повышенной нагрузке.
Нынешние базы данных обеспечивают стабильность содержания исключительно существенной данных. Системы резервного сохранения защищают информацию от пропажи при отказах техники.
Систематизация информации в структурированном формате
Структурирование данных составляет собой основополагающий способ деятельности баз данных. Информация распределяются по матрицам, где каждая запись вмещает индивидуальную элемент, а столбцы задают характеристики единиц. Такая система обеспечивает логически группировать однородную информацию.
Каждая матрица в базе данных обладает точную схему с установленными атрибутами. Поле составляет собой отдельный атрибут элемента, например имя пользователя или стоимость товара. Гарантирует единообразие содержания информации и облегчает её обработку.
Структурированная система сведений охватывает несколько значимых элементов:
- Первичные ключи для единственной определения записей
- Виды данных для управления вида информации
- Индексы для оптимизации поиска по матрицам
- Требования согласованности для предотвращения неточностей
Грамотная структура базы данных предотвращает дублирование информации. Уменьшает объём содержащихся сведений и оптимизирует изменение. Оптимизация таблиц устраняет повторение.
Сохранение больших количеств данных и моментальный доступ к ним
Современные базы данных в состоянии размещать терабайты и петабайты сведений. Значительные организации аккумулируют миллиарды данных о клиентах и платежах. up x улучшает использование накопительного объёма и оперативной памяти.
Оперативность доступа к информации сохраняется жизненно значимым показателем работы баз данных. Участники предполагают быстрых результатов на команды даже при анализе миллионов записей. Индексирование таблиц даёт возможность обнаруживать требуемые информацию за части секунды.
Буферизация постоянно запрашиваемых информации улучшает функционирование программ. База данных сохраняет распространённые запросы в оперативной памяти для моментального обращения. Уменьшает напряжение на накопительную компоненту и улучшает быстродействие платформы.
Распределённые базы данных хранят сведения на нескольких узлах. Такая конфигурация гарантирует линейное масштабирование и управление расширяющихся объёмов информации.
Отношения между данными и логика их организации
Взаимосвязи между матрицами образуют базис структурированных баз данных. Разнообразные форматы информации объединяются через особые ключевые поля, создавая непротиворечивую платформу. ап икс предоставляет логическую целостность и единообразие совокупной структуры.
Связующие коды определяют соединения между матрицами. Поле в одной схеме отсылает на главный ключ другой таблицы, формируя отношение между записями. Такая структура даёт возможность содержать информацию о клиентах изолированно от данных о покупках.
Базы данных обеспечивают несколько типов отношений между матрицами:
- Один к одному — каждая элемент связана с одной строкой
- Один ко многим — одна элемент привязана с различными элементами
- Многие ко многим — множественные элементы ассоциированы между собой
Упорядочение данных предотвращает дублирование и улучшает организацию базы. Сегментирует сведения на последовательные кластеры и устанавливает корректные соединения. Процедура стандартизации повышает результативность хранения данных.
Задействование баз данных в обычных платформах
Базы данных работают в фоновом формате фактически каждого компьютерного службы. Социальные сети размещают страницы участников, снимки и уведомления в гигантских базах данных. Каждое активность — добавление сообщения или комментарий — фиксируется в платформу и становится достижимым для остальных клиентов.
Интернет-магазины используют базы данных для организации ассортиментом продуктов и переработки покупок. ап икс официальный сайт обеспечивает немедленно изменять информацию о доступности изделий и выводить текущие расценки. Комплексы рекомендаций анализируют архив заказов и советуют товары на фундаменте интересов.
Банковские программы переработывают миллионы платежей ежесуточно. База данных фиксирует каждый операцию и платёж с скрупулёзностью до копейки. Подтверждает безопасность денежной данных и исключает неразрешённый доступ.
Маршрутные службы содержат карты и информацию о заторах в профильных базах. Системы заказа управляют доступностью позиций и обрабатывают запросы в состоянии текущего времени.
Безопасность и обеспечение данных в базах данных
Защита информации составляет собой ключевую миссию каждой структуры управления базами. Закрытая сведения пользователей и платёжные записи запрашивают надёжной безопасности от неавторизованного подключения. Многослойная комплекс защищённости контролирует каждое запрос к информации.
Верификация пользователей проверяет персону каждого, кто подключается к базе данных. Платформы требуют набора учётной записи и пароля, а также могут использовать двухфакторную проверку. up x разделяет полномочия обращения для разных типов клиентов.
Криптование данных оберегает информацию при хранении и транспортировке по сети. База данных трансформирует доступный текст в зашифрованный код, который нельзя прочитать без уникального кода. Обеспечивает конфиденциальность даже при непосредственном доступе к машинам.
Журналирование операций регистрирует все шаги пользователей в базе данных. Механизм сохраняет время обращения и завершённые обращения. Проверка даёт возможность обнаружить необычную действия.
Актуализация и выравнивание сведений в мгновенном времени
Нынешние базы данных выполняют правки информации немедленно. Когда пользователь изменяет профиль или осуществляет заказ, система оперативно записывает обновлённые информацию. up x официальный сайт гарантирует актуальность информации для всех участников совместно.
Координация данных между несколькими машинами обеспечивает целостность разнесённых структур. Корректировки, произведённые на одном машине, самостоятельно копируются на прочие машины. ап икс исключает разночтения в данных и гарантирует единообразие сведений.
Коллизии при одновременном модификации одних и тех же элементов устраняются специализированными процедурами. База данных блокирует элементы на момент изменения или применяет гибкую подход регулирования. Комплекс контролирует версии сведений и исключает исчезновение модификаций.
Дублирование информации формирует дубликаты базы на пространственно распределённых хостах. Клиенты обретают подключение к локальному машине, что снижает задержки. Усиливает надёжность комплекса при сбоях устройств.
Архивное сохранение и возврат сведений
Запасное дублирование оберегает базы данных от пропажи чрезвычайно ценной сведений. Механизмы самостоятельно формируют реплики информации через установленные периоды времени. Дублирующие реплики хранятся на изолированных устройствах или внешних машинах.
Тотальное сохранение генерирует слепок всей базы данных в конкретный момент времени. Такие реплики дают возможность реконструировать платформу целиком. Реализует тотальное дублирование еженедельно или помесячно в зависимости от количества сведений.
Инкрементное сохранение фиксирует только модификации, возникшие с момента предшествующей резервной реплики. Такой метод сберегает ресурс на устройствах и ускоряет процесс. Объединяет целое и добавочное копирование для наилучшего баланса.
Реконструкция информации переводит базу в функциональное состояние после отказов или неточностей. Администраторы назначают нужную резервную реплику и активируют операцию восстановления. ап икс официальный сайт сокращает длительность бездействия и пропажу сведений при аварийных условиях.
Функция баз данных в деятельности нынешних приложений и ресурсов
Базы данных составляют фундамент произвольного актуального веб-приложения или портативного службы. Без комплексов управления данными нереализуема действие интернет-платформ, которыми пользуются миллиарды человек ежесуточно. Каждый клик или шаг участника контактирует с базой данных.
Динамический наполнение порталов формируется на базе данных из баз данных. Информационные порталы получают заметки, обсуждения подгружают посты, а видеохостинги извлекают информацию роликов. Это даёт возможность генерировать настроенный материал для каждого пользователя.
Карманные программы координируют сведения с сетевыми базами для гарантирования подключения с отличающихся девайсов. Пользователь начинает взаимодействие на мобильнике и ведёт на планшете без исчезновения продвижения. ап икс гарантирует бесшовный опыт задействования на разнообразии систем.
Исследовательские комплексы обрабатывают сведения из баз для выработки деловых заключений. Компании анализируют активность клиентов и прогнозируют потребность. ап икс официальный сайт превращает сырые сведения в ценные заключения для развития решений.